NDAA and Blue UAS Framework Compliant Drone and LiDAR System
Description
Oregon State University intends to contract with Fagerman Technologies, Inc. for the purchase of an NDAA‑compliant drone and LiDAR system to support federally funded forestry research as a sole source because of the uniqueness (design, capability, nature) of the goods and the contractor being the only provider able to meet critical parameters or timeframes to support the research and/or business needs of the university. The selected system must be NDAA compliant and approved for use in federally funded projects under the Blue UAS framework, support stable flight while carrying a LiDAR payload, and provide a minimum flight time of at least 30 minutes (with longer endurance preferred for field operations). It must enable autonomous flight planning and execution for repeatable data collection and include a LiDAR sensor capable of centimeter‑level accuracy (approximately 2.5 cm). The system must capture both canopy and ground returns, maintain high point density suitable for forestry analysis (~300+ points/m²) when operating at approximately 100 meters above ground level, and function as a fully integrated drone‑LiDAR platform. Additionally, the system must be available for delivery within the project timeline.
